- Emotional Intelligence: controlling and expressing emotions. Main elements are self-awareness, self-regulation, motivation, empathy, social skills.

- Grace: a spiritual gift that involves love and mercy given to others even when we feel that they don’t deserve it.
- Growth Mindset: believing that success depends on time and effort, skills and intelligence can be improved with effort and persistence. Embrace challenges, persist through obstacles, learn from criticism, be inspired by other people’s success.
